Historical & Cultural Background

Talya is a name of Hebrew origin, often associated with nature and spirituality. In Hebrew culture, names often carry significant meanings related to faith and the natural world. The Arabic variant reflects a connection to growth and beauty. The name has gained popularity in various cultures, particularly among those who appreciate its lyrical sound.

U.S. Historical Usage

The name Talya was first seen in the United States in 1961. Talya has ranked as high as #1291 nationally, which occurred in 2014, and has been most popular in California, New York, Florida, Texas, and New Jersey. In the past 5 years the name Talya has been trending down compared to the previous 5 years.
